Interior Ministry urges citizens not to travel during Easter holidays

Photo: BGNES

The measures announced in Bulgaria for restricting movement between the regional cities remain in force for the four non-working days on the Easter holidays (17 April to 20 April). This was stated at a briefing of the Ministry of Interior this morning.

Checks of 9312 randomly selected declarations stating reasons for travel left at the checkpoints of the cities show that the data in 721 of them was incorrect, according to the Ministry of Interior.
Police teams continue to monitor the compliance with anti-epidemic measures in Bulgaria.
